The Bier- und Oktoberfestmuseum brings together two Munich obsessions—beer and the Oktoberfest—and ties them directly to the city’s deep timeline. It opened on 7 September 2005 and is set inside a town house in the old town dating back to 1327, so the museum experience begins with medieval walls rather than modern exhibits. Access is down a staircase with 43 steps that runs over four floors, and that stairway is nearly 500 years old—a detail that turns the building itself into part of the story. Operated by the Edith-Haberland-Wagner-Stiftung, the museum focuses on how beer culture shaped Munich and how the Oktoberfest grew from local tradition into a world-famous festival. …
